Prominent pros & cons

PROS

Tungsten RPA provides valuable tools for integrating with third-party support and productivity services.
The platform is stable and scalable, making it suitable for growing business needs.
The pricing of Tungsten RPA is considered quite good compared to similar tools.
Tungsten RPA allows for website automation, making it easy to interact with any website efficiently.
It is a low-code platform, making it accessible for users without a computer science background.

CONS

Tungsten RPA needs more comprehensive AI capabilities, including improved exception handling and OCR with enhanced multi-language support.
Scalability and performance issues are areas needing improvement in Tungsten RPA.
Tungsten RPA lacks a free, widely available training portal and accessible documentation.
Tungsten RPA could benefit from modular licensing and improved integration with SAP and Microsoft.
Challenges exist with Tungsten RPA's desktop automation and sending emails with multiple attachments.
